Introduced by Rep. Patrick Green (D) on January 18, 2017
To require the Michigan Catastrophic Claims Association (MCCA) to disclose actuarial computation used in rate setting. The MCCA is the reinsurance provider that covers unlimited vehicle crash medical claims when they go above $545,000, coverage that is mandated by the state no-fault auto insurance law.
